我注意到,每当我运行任何ADFv2管道(HDInsightHive活动)时,就会在默认存储中为群集创建容器“ adfjobs”(如果尚不存在)。另外,该容器下会出现一个文件夹(由于其基于Blob而称为伪文件夹)HiveQueryJobs,该容器反过来似乎正在存储各种运行实例的日志。我们可以在ADF主动性中更改此路径吗?我还没有看到任何这样的选择。这是一个不错的选择,可以说我们希望为每次运行的日志文件(例如pipelinename / date_id)创建一个更具逻辑意义的路径。
答案 0 :(得分:0)
不幸的是,您无法更改Azure Data Factory作业日志的位置。
默认情况下,Azure数据工厂创建一个文件夹名称“ adfjobs”来存储ADF作业日志。
“ adflogs”文件夹保存具有有意义路径的日志文件。
示例:我已提交了mapreduce作业,与此作业相关的日志文件位于路径“ adfjobs / MapReduceJobs / 04e3074c-b641-4a1d-b766-29bc48b41884 / 13_08_2019_05_13_43_619 / Status
”中,该路径具有有意义的路径“ logs folder / Jobtype / RunID / Timestamp / Status of job
”。
希望这会有所帮助。